Makers of generic metoclopramide and branded Reglan March 27 won judgment in the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Louisiana in a family’s birth defect suit stemming from alleged off-label promotion of the drug to treat morning sickness (Whitener v. Pliva, Inc., E.D. La., 2:10-cv-01552-EEF-KWR, 3/27/14).
Joshua and Lindsay Whitener alleged Lindsay was prescribed generic metoclopramide off-label, resulting in injuries both to Lindsay and their later-born son, Lucas.
